Police have launched a murder investigation after a young woman was found dead in east London.

The woman, in her 20s, was found suffering critical injuries after reports of an ‘assault’ in Chadwell Heath at 5.30am.

Paramedics fought to save the woman but she sadly pronounced dead at the scene.

Although formal identification has yet to take place, officers believe the victim was in her twenties.

Police say a post-mortem examination is being held to determine the nature of her injuries.

Her family have been informed of the death and are being supported by family liaison officers.

No arrests have yet been made at this early stage in the investigation.

Detective Superintendent Brian Hobbs said: ‘Our thoughts today are with the victim’s family and friends in light of this truly tragic event.

‘Local residents will see an increased number of officers in and around the area while our investigative work is carried out. I want to thank residents for their patience while this continues. I would ask anyone who was in the area of Romford, who may have seen or heard anything suspicious, to come forward to us.’
